audk/IntelFrameworkModulePkg
Star Zeng ece4c1de3e IntelFrameworkModulePkg/FwVolDxe: Ensure FfsFileHeader 8 bytes aligned
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=864
REF: CVE-2018-3630

To follow PI spec, ensure FfsFileHeader 8 bytes aligned.

Current code only handles (FwVolHeader->ExtHeaderOffset != 0) path,
update code to also handle (FwVolHeader->ExtHeaderOffset == 0) path.

Cc: Jiewen Yao <jiewen.yao@intel.com>
Cc: Liming Gao <liming.gao@intel.com>
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Star Zeng <star.zeng@intel.com>
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
2019-02-28 18:22:53 +08:00
..
Bus IntelFrameworkModulePkg: Avoid key notification called more than once 2018-09-14 10:18:31 +08:00
Csm IntelFrameworkModulePkg: Avoid key notification called more than once 2018-09-14 10:18:31 +08:00
Include IntelFrameworkModulePkg: Clean up source files 2018-06-28 11:19:42 +08:00
Library IntelFrameworkModulePkg: Fix UEFI and Tiano Decompression logic issue 2018-11-11 11:48:37 +08:00
Universal IntelFrameworkModulePkg/FwVolDxe: Ensure FfsFileHeader 8 bytes aligned 2019-02-28 18:22:53 +08:00
IntelFrameworkModulePkg.dec IntelFrameworkModulePkg: Clean up source files 2018-06-28 11:19:42 +08:00
IntelFrameworkModulePkg.dsc IntelFrameworkModulePkg: fix build for AARCH64/ARM 2019-02-04 17:08:30 +00:00
IntelFrameworkModulePkg.uni IntelFrameworkModulePkg AcpiS3SaveDxe: Remove S3Ready() functional code 2016-04-07 17:32:03 +02:00
IntelFrameworkModulePkgExtra.uni IntelFrameworkModulePkg: Clean up source files 2018-06-28 11:19:42 +08:00